Guibemantis tornieri (Ahl, 1928)

Class: Amphibia > Order: Anura > Family: Mantellidae > Subfamily: Mantellinae > Genus: Guibemantis

[link to this account]

Rhacophorus tornieri Ahl, 1928, Zool. Anz., 75: 316. Holotype: ZMB unnumbered in original publication; ZMB 30533 according to Guibé, 1978, Bonn. Zool. Monogr., 11: 23. Type locality: "Ankoraka, Sahambendrana (Zentral-Madagascar)".

Rhacophorus (Rhacophorus) tornieri — Ahl, 1931, Das Tierreich, 55: 199.

Boophis tornieri — Guibé, 1947, Bull. Mus. Natl. Hist. Nat. Paris, Ser. 2, 19: 439.

Mantidactylus tornieri — Blommers-Schlösser, 1978, Genetica, 48: 30. Blommers-Schlösser, 1979, Beaufortia, 29: 35, 40, who also provided an account.

Mantidactylus (Guibemantis) tornieri — Dubois, 1992, Bull. Mens. Soc. Linn. Lyon, 61: 312.

Guibemantis (Guibemantis) tornieri — Vences and Glaw, 2006, in Vences et al. (eds.), Calls Frogs Madagascar: 16. Glaw and Vences, 2006, Organisms Divers. Evol., 6: 246; by implication; Glaw and Vences, 2006, Organisms Divers. Evol., Electron. Suppl., 11(1): 2.

Distribution

Eas-central and outheastern Madagascar.

Comment

Blommers-Schlösser, 1979, Beaufortia, 29: 35, 40, removed this species from the synonymy of Mantidactylus depressiceps, where it had been placed by Guibé, 1975 "1974", Bull. Mus. Natl. Hist. Nat. Paris, Ser. 3, Zool., 266: 1761. Glaw and Vences, 2007, Field Guide Amph. Rept. Madagascar, Ed. 3: 200-201, provided an account.
